    • An electric spoiler control method. The electric spoiler control method comprises: acquiring the current position of an spoiler, and determining, according to the current position of the spoiler and a preset position of the spoiler, whether the spoiler is offset (S 1); when it is determined that the spoiler is offset, outputting an offset signal related to the offset of the spoiler (S2); when a confirmation adjustment signal for the offset signal is detected, controlling the spoiler to enter an spoiler self-learning state, wherein the spoiler self-learning state comprises controlling the spoiler to execute a preset learning action between a plurality of calibration positions (S3); and acquiring an actual position of the spoiler, and when it is detected that an offset value between the actual position and the corresponding calibration position is less than a preset offset value, determining that spoiler self-learning is successful (S4). Further disclosed are an electric spoiler control apparatus, and an electronic device, a vehicle and a computer program product, which include the control method. By means of the control method, the problem of it being impossible to correct the angle of an spoiler in time when the spoiler is offset is solved, thus effectively improving the applicability of the spoiler.

    • This wind power generation device includes a plurality of rotary blades 15 around a rotation axis. Each rotary blade 15 includes a front blade surface 16 parallel to the rotation axis and curved so as to protrude frontward in a rotation direction, and a rear blade surface 17 located on the back side of the front blade surface 16, being parallel to the rotation axis, being curved so as to be concave frontward in the rotation direction, and having a smaller curve depth than the front blade surface 16. The front blade surface 16 includes a first curved surface 19 forming a part far from the rotation axis and formed frontward in the rotation direction from an outer end 21 of the rotary blade 15, and a second curved surface 20 forming a part close to the rotation axis L1 and formed rearward in the rotation direction from a crest 18 of the front blade surface 16 so as to connect to an inner end 22, a surface length thereof in a plan view being smaller than that of the first curved surface 19. The first curved surface 19 has recesses 23 at positions closer to the outer end 21 than to the crest 18 of the front blade surface 16. Thus, a rotary blade that rotates by receiving a fluid and can improve rotation efficiency, is provided.
